Output 80ad3ec7dea7aa72e190c5d817c04c9e6ce0bc6f26baa57d8fb14bfbd745c10b:0

value
895900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b6975bacf8984d812faf35c183b77629bb0ac6 OP_EQUAL
address
39n685zBMdNgtJPsvAqacxNbwo9Tnatimy
transaction
80ad3ec7dea7aa72e190c5d817c04c9e6ce0bc6f26baa57d8fb14bfbd745c10b
spent
true